David Russo offers a wealth of experience in planned giving and corporate relations for both national and local organizations.
David is the Associate Director of Gift Planning for the Lucile Packard Foundation for Children’s Health. He is responsible for building and stewarding relationships with donors and estate and financial planning professionals to provide information about Lucile Packard Children’s Hospital Stanford and its life-saving critical care and research programs for children and families across the Bay area, county, and the globe. He coordinates suggestions for planned giving vehicles and strategic giving to facilitate constituent desires to improve health outcomes for all. His responsibilities also include trust administration, gift agreements, and due diligence.
David brings over sixteen years of charitable gift planning experience. Before the foundation, he was the Planned Giving and Corporate Relations for Santa Clara County Catholic Charities. He was the Director of Estate and Gift Planning for the American Cancer Society, Inc. serving the Silicon Valley and Central Coast regions, and the Planned Giving Associate at the Silicon Valley Community Foundation. While there, he established their charitable gift annuity program, facilitated the highly successful real estate gift platform, and administered their $50 million remainder trust portfolio.
